There are many different ways people try to lose weight. Since each person’s body reacts differently to the vast methods of weight loss, there is no one sure-fire way that will give you 100% results you are looking for. The best way to go about your weight loss journey is to exercise regularly, eat healthy and be consistent.

Fruits and berries are extremely popular as diet foods and have been highly recommended for those people who have attained their desired weight. The main benefit of fruits and berries is that they are extremely easy to  incorporate into your daily diet. Some of these diet foods are as follows.

Avocados

Avocados are quite different when compared to other kinds of fruits as they contain a large amount of fats rather than carbs. Apart from fats, they also contain a fairly good amount of vitamin C, fiber and potassium.

Apples

Apples are known to be a good diet food as they contain vitamin C, fiber and an abundance of

Antioxidants. If you are someone who keeps snacking between meals, substitute those snacks with apples.

Oranges

Oranges are a good source of vitamin C, they contain a vast amount of it. Adding oranges to your diet can benefit you as well since they are also high in antioxidants and fiber.

Bananas

Bananas are an immensely good diet food as they contain a large amount of potassium. Consuming a banana when you feel the urge to snack between meals are a perfect solution and a much healthier alternative. They also contain amounts of fiber and vitamin B6.

Strawberries

Strawberries are another great fruit for those looking to lose weight as they contain a relatively low amount of calories as well as carbs. This diet food is loaded with manganese, fiber and vitamin C.

Vegetables

Everyone knows how important vegetables are, they are rich in nutrients and can be added to various dishes. By adding vegetables to your daily diet, you can fasten your weight loss journey. It is advisable to implement and alternate these vegetables listed below every day.

Bell peppers

Bell peppers are another good diet food source as it contains large amounts of vitamin C and good antioxidant properties. They come in many colors (yellow peppers, green peppers, red peppers, etc.), one of the main benefits is that they can be added to any dish for flavor.

Broccoli

Broccoli is one those vegetables that can be consumed either cooked or in raw form. This cruciferous vegetable is rich in vitamin K, vitamin C, protein and fiber.

Carrots

Carrots are a good diet food for those looking to lose weight. They are loaded with an abundance of important nutrients such as fiber, vitamin K, etc. Carrots are known to contain high levels of carotene antioxidant properties which have various health benefits.

Tomatoes

Tomatoes are one of those vegetables that are labelled as fruits by many. This age old debate can vary based on where you reside and what you were taught in school. However, they are a good diet food because of the amount of vitamin C and potassium they contain.

Remember that most vegetables are considered to be healthy, they can have many benefits on the body and help maintain good health. Some of the other sought after vegetables worth mentioning to include in your diet are cabbage, lettuce, radishes, mushrooms, turnips, zucchini, artichokes, celery and Brussels sprouts.
